2675950
0xefd12298cb24f3c35005d21443389f8a05c7071d406dae4f670449052cbdcd0c
Transactions0
Height2675950
Confirmations7309907
Timestamp590 days 20 hours ago
Size (bytes)506
Version
Merkle Root
Nonce0x446d69dabe987af0
Bits
Difficulty0x15e6c